Statistical Matchup

The game also pits Portland's No. 7-ranked offense averaging 108.03 PPG, against a New York Knicks defense that ranks No. 25 at 108.68 PPG. The Portland Trail Blazers field goal percentage has averaged 45.95% so far, more than the New York Knicks shooters have achieved on the year, 44.74% per game.

Recent Outings Betting Recap

The Knicks endured a 108-101 loss at the hands of the Jazz on Wednesday, despite a 24-point effort from Kristaps Porzingis at Vivint Smart Home Arena.

The Trail Blazers got a terrific 31-point performance from Damian Lillard but Milwaukee handed them a 93-90 defeat on Tuesday at Moda Center.
